Appartement adjacent au parc du château de Giusso, composé de 1 chambre double, dressing, salle de bain avec douche, salon avec coin cuisine et terrasse. Équipé de la climatisation et du chauffage indépendant, l'appartement est complet avec réfrigérateur, congélateur, four, four micro-ondes, lave-vaisselle, lave-linge, fer et planche à repasser, balai électrique, machine à café américaine, vaisselle, draps et serviettes, peignoir. Dans le salon: canapé-lit, TV LCD, lecteur DVD, chaîne stéréo avec radio et lecteur CD, petite bibliothèque également équipée de DVD, table péninsule pour quatre personnes avec tabourets, table avec quatre chaises pour une utilisation intérieure / extérieure. Terrasse avec chaises longues, barbecue. Sur la terrasse, il est facile de dîner en 4/6 personnes devant une vue imprenable sur le golfe de Naples et le Vésuve. La maison dans la zone piétonne est à quelques minutes du centre de Vico Equense et de la gare Circumvesuviana, facilitant ainsi les voyages à Sorrente, Pompéi, Castellammare di Stabia, Naples. L'arrêt de bus est à 200 mètres et vous permet de rejoindre: Monte Faito, (1 131 m d'altitude où des promenades dans les bois sont possibles), l'aéroport de Naples-Capodichino. Le Circumvesuviana vous permet d'atteindre Sorrente en quelques minutes à partir desquelles vous pouvez rejoindre Positano, Amalfi, Ravello, Furore en bus et en bateau ou en hydroptère Capri, Ischia, Procida. Toujours à deux cents mètres de la fameuse Pizza au mètre, près de l'appartement plusieurs parkings payants, location de scooters, épiceries, bars, pâtisseries, cafés, église, hôpital, gare des carabiniers, police de la circulation, office de tourisme, musée minéralogie. A proximité immédiate (environ 1 km) spa, centre de massage et établissements balnéaires.

This location is perfect if you are looking for a hub for everything Amalfi Coast. The boat to Capri, Amalfi and Positano is walking distance down a steep hill. The train is literally a 3 minute walk where you can get to Pompeii, Naples, etc. Finding the place the first day is tough! Have your taxi drop you at Pizzeria da Franco. Directly next to them is the ally you walk down to the flat. Once you get to the church door the landlord's helper will call out to you (make sure to give exact arrival time!). By the way P da Franco is EXCELLENT for cheap/delicious pizza, as well as breakfast coffees and pastries. The flat: Clean and simple. It is all about the terrace! We were in heaven sitting outside taking in the stunning views of the Bay of Naples. Be aware that the washing machine only takes liquid detergent; there was some there for us. Bedding/towels etc. are not what we spoiled Americans are used to; you dry items outside and they are rough even with fabric softener. The reviews are correct in that the upstairs neighbors scream at each other late into the night but we found it very entertaining! Turn your own music up loud and they close their window. Highly recommend you visit the tourist office down the street rather than planning your own tours - a life saver. Must go to Il Barro restaurant for the best pasta EVER. Would stay again!

This is a very nicely renovated apartment stocked with all amenities in an old building. The terrace offers an absolutely stupendous view and the Circumvesuviana train for exploring the area is just steps away. But now we come to the fly, or flies, in the ointment: be prepared to endure constant screaming matches from the tenants above plus loud rap music from time to time. Also, with almost nightly functions at the Castello next door and pounding music at times past midnight, this apartment may not be suitable for people looking for peace and quiet. We put up with it because we just loved the view.
